Module Expectations

Beacon provides two formats for online learning: courses and modules. Courses are facilitated by trained content-area specialists and include multiple summative assessments that must be approved by the course facilitator. Modules are non-facilitated and are assessed with multiple-choice quizzes. This article addresses module expectations.

Module Expectations

  • Read course content, complete Check Your Understanding activities, view video clips, and visit external web links and other resources in each chapter prior to attempting the quizzes.
  • Quizzes cannot be accessed prior to the start date.
  • Learners must score 80 percent or better on each quiz. Learners can retake the quizzes as needed to attain a passing score. A time delay allows the learner to review content prior to taking a quiz again.
  • Automatic withdrawal occurs after the end date of the module if all quizzes have not been successfully completed.
